Rudyard Kipling (1865-1936) Was an English Journalist, Short-Story Writer, Poet, and Novelist. «The Naulahka» is a remarkable work of fiction by Rudyard Kipling and Wolcott Balestier, came under severe criticism by a section of the society for its alleged anti-feminist contents when it was first published in 1892
